MP Barrett and his team are always happy to hear from their constituents. Our offices are here to serve you and provide a wide variety of services. We can provide information and assistance on federal government issues, including but not limited to, Citizenship and Immigration, Passport Canada, Canada Pension Plan, Employment Insurance, etc. The Office of MP Barrett is currently looking to staff the position of Constituency Assistant on a 6-month basis with the possibility of extension. In this role, you will manage, triage and review Member’s emails and communications, prioritize, sort and evaluate correspondence and distribute key information to constituents. You will act as the first line of response with constituents for all incoming cases while providing administrative and business services to the Member. Primary responsibilities: Creates and maintains systems to monitor requests and/or questions from constituents. Assist constituents for all incoming cases (e.g. immigration, Canada Revenue and Old Age Security files) and provides information, advice and support in person, over the telephone and in writing. Manage the Members and the office calendar, including events, meeting requests and scheduling logistics. Contacts government services on behalf of constituents to obtain more information and follow up on available national programs as well as to seek and achieve resolution in all cases and follows up with constituents throughout the client file life cycle. Ensures cases are dealt with in a sensitive, confidential and timely manner. Drafts responses to constituent emails and letters, including on general policy and constituency casework issues. Helps with special projects that aim to improve the effectiveness of the office’s administrative operations. Performs other related duties within the scope of the position. Top reasons to apply: By joining the team at the Office of MP Barrett, you will join a meaningful environment that helps make a tangible impact on your community. You will collaborate with your peers, and work with a wide range of stakeholders and clients. This role will help develop your career in research and writing, event planning and communications. Start date: As soon as possible. Education: Post-secondary education from a recognized institution OR an acceptable combination of education, training and relevant experience Experiences: Experience working in an office setting providing reception or administrative support. Experience in a client service environment. Experience prioritizing and maintaining relationships with multiple stakeholders by exhibiting strong attention to detail, adaptability, and analytical skills. Experience collaborating with others and working in a team. Knowledge and understanding of the Conservative Party of Canada as well as the current political landscape. Assets: Experience working with a Member of Parliament or a political office. Ability to speak French. Members of Parliament are individual employers who are responsible for recruiting, hiring and managing the employees who help them carry out their parliamentary duties. Terms and conditions of employment vary from one MP's office to another.
